GriefShare, Surviving the Holidays

Wondering how you will survive the weeks surrounding Thanksgiving and Christmas? Are you dreading these holidays, knowing that everything has changed and that happy memories from past years can’t be recreated?
 
Surviving the Holidays seminar is especially for people who are grieving a loved one’s death. You’ll learn:
 
· How to deal with the many emotions you’ll face during the holidays
· What to do about traditions and other coming changes
· Helpful tips for surviving social events
· How to discover hope for your future
 
Please come join us for a two-hour seminar: Griefshare Surviving the Holidays. There will be two opportunities for this event November 13th, 1:30-3:30 or November 16th, 6 pm-8 pm. Please register on the Griefshare website or sign up on the bulletin outside of the church office. Contact Jillian Flynn with any questions.
